Transaction 65b99777a169363efa17da70c8f72d0f4a60b165409e1422c097ba50b1c9ccdb
1 Input
1 Output
-
65b99777a169363efa17da70c8f72d0f4a60b165409e1422c097ba50b1c9ccdb:0
- value
- 765644
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 223008b6124731af6ed71b041c40f5ea10dbbe8a OP_EQUAL
- address
- 34onSXd4G3wjATohS4oeQ3fBonhPS5hXBU